stopintime

Some 696 riders have raised their bikes by changing a shock/frame mounting clevis, from a M1100.
Don't know specifics or if/how it can be done on yours, but probably worth looking into.

The front can be lowered by adjusting where the fork sits, in the top and lower triple.

There are probably lots of bar risers out there. Rizoma bars have further rise and sweepback angle.

Raux

buy the $20 dollar suspension mount clevis for the 696 to lower the rear
pull the forks through to lower the front
